NIA Patna Branch DSP and his 2 agents arrested for taking bribe

Central Bureau of Investigation (CBI), in coordination with the National Investigation Agency, arrested NIA Patna Branch DSP and his two agents for accepting the illegal gratification of Rs 20 lakhs, officials said on Thursday.

Patna (Bihar) [India], October 4 (ANI): The Central Bureau of Investigation (CBI), in coordination with the National Investigation Agency (NIA), arrested NIA Patna Branch DSP and his two agents for accepting an illegal gratification of Rs 20 lakh, officials said on Thursday.
According to officials, the CBI and NIA set a trap after receiving a complaint about corrupt activities by the accused officer.
The CBI had received information that one Rocky Yadav, owner of Ramaiya Construction, was alleging corrupt practices by the NIA Patna Branch Investigating Officer during the course of an NIA investigation against him.
After verifying the inputs and acting promptly in coordination with the NIA, the CBI laid a trap, officials said.
During the operation, the CBI apprehended the accused Investigating Officer, Deputy SP Ajay Pratap Singh, along with his two agents, while they were accepting illegal gratification of Rs 20 lakh from the complainant.
Further investigation is underway. (ANI)
